BINI, Ben&Ben, Lola Amour, Cup of Joe and more OPM artists shines bright at 38th Awit Awards

The 38th Awit Awards delivered a vibrant celebration of Original Pilipino Music (OPM) as the nation's most credible and long-standing music honors returned to the Meralco Theater on November 16, 2025.
For 38 years, the Awit Awards—organized by the Philippine Association of the Record Industry (PARI)—has stood as the country's premier platform recognizing Filipino musical artistry, originality, and achievement.
This year's ceremony embraced a renewed mission: to honor the best in OPM while championing innovation, digital reach, and fan-centered engagement. The result was a show that felt both iconic and refreshingly contemporary.
Below are the official winners of the 38th Awit Awards:
Grand Awards
• Album of the Year - Ben&Ben
• Record of the Year - Lola Amour
• Song of the Year - Cup of Joe - “Misteryoso”
Performance Awards
• Solo Artist - Dionela
• Best Performance by a Group - Ben&Ben
• Best Performance by a Solo Artist - iLA
• Best Performance by a New Group - 12th Street
• Best Collaboration - Dionela and Jay-R
• Best Dance/Electronic Recording - BINI - “Salamin, Salamin”
• Best Global Collaboration Recording - SB19, Terry Zhong - “Moonlight”
Genre Recording Awards
• Best Ballad Recording - Moira, Juan Karlos
• Best Rock Recording - Fast Pitch
• Best Alternative Recording - Lola Amour
• Best Alternative Rock Recording - Ice Seguerra
• Best Rap/Hip-Hop Recording - SB19 and Gloc-9
• Best Jazz Recording - Devonaire District and Alvin Cornista
• Best Instrumental Recording - Alvin Cornista
• Best World Music Recording - Over Heat and CamSur Made
• Best Recording by a Child or for Children - Ateneo Boys Choir
Special Recording Awards
• Regional Recording - Juan Karlos and Kyle Echarri + Noel Cabangon
• Best Christmas Recording - Devonaire District
• Original Soundtrack Recording - Regine Velasquez
• Best Novelty Recording - Introvert Fiesta ft. AJi
• Inspirational Recording - December Avenue
• Best Pop Recording - Maki - “Dilaw”
• Best R&B Recording - Jay-R and Dionela
Technical Achievement Awards
• Sound Engineer of Best Winning Recording - Axel Fernandez
• Best Musical Arrangement - Khalil Refuerzo
• Best Vocal Arrangement - Luke Isnani, Felip Suson
• Best Remix Recording - Ena Mori and Kenyema
• Best Cover Art - SB19
• Best Music Video - SB19 and Gloc-9
